Analyzing the Cabinet's Problem



When starting the reconstruction process, start by evaluating the problem of the antique cupboard. Thoroughly examine the total framework for any kind of indicators of damages such as cracks, chips, or loose joints. Examine the wood for any kind of rot, bending, or insect problem that may have taken place with time. It's crucial to establish the level of the restoration required before continuing even more.

Next off, inspect the cupboard's hardware such as hinges, knobs, and locks. Make note of any missing pieces or components that require repair service or substitute. Ensure that all equipment is working correctly and securely affixed to the cupboard.

Furthermore, assess the cupboard's finish. Try to find laminate supplier , discolorations, or staining that may impact the visual appeal. Gathering the Necessary Tools and Materials



After evaluating the condition of the antique cupboard, the next step is to gather the necessary devices and materials for the remediation procedure. Before you start, ensure you have the complying with things available:

- wood cleaner
- sandpaper in numerous grits
- wood filler
- paint or wood tarnish
- brushes
- handwear covers
- safety goggles
- a dust mask
- a ground cloth
- a putty knife
- a hammer
- a screwdriver
- a vacuum cleaner

These tools and products are necessary for a successful repair.

Wood cleaner is crucial for getting rid of years of dust and crud accumulation, preparing the surface area for sanding. Sandpaper of different grits assists in smoothing out imperfections and preparing the wood for a new surface. Timber filler comes in handy for fixing any cracks, holes, or dents present in the closet.

Repaint or wood tarnish, in addition to brushes, allow you to personalize the cabinet to your choice. Bear in mind to wear gloves, safety goggles, and a dust mask for defense. Put down a drop cloth to shield your workplace, and make use of a hoover to clean up any particles.

Carrying Out the Reconstruction Process



To efficiently carry out the restoration process on your antique cupboard, start by thoroughly cleansing the surface area with the wood cleaner. This step is critical as it helps get rid of years of dirt, gunk, and old gloss that may have collected externally.

As soon as the closet is clean and dry, analyze the condition of the timber. Search for any kind of cracks, scratches, or other problems that require to be dealt with. Usage timber filler to repair any type of imperfections, ensuring to match the filler color to the wood tone for a smooth finish.



After the repair services have actually dried, delicately sand the whole surface to produce a smooth and also base for the brand-new finish. Beware not to sand too boldy, as you don't intend to damage the timber underneath.
